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Robben's Roost Roller Skating (Louisville, KY)
Robben's Roost Roller Skating is situated in Louisville, Kentucky, specifically in the 40218 zip code, which lies south of the city center. The venue is located off Six Mile Lane, a key thoroughfare that provides access to larger arteries like Southside Drive and Preston Highway. These main roads connect directly to I-264 (Watterson Expressway) and I-65, offering relatively straightforward access for those arriving from different parts of the city or region. Parking is generally available on-site, which is a significant convenience for a venue often bustling with families and groups. For those relying on public transit, Louisville's TARC bus system operates routes in the vicinity, though direct service to the roller rink might require a short walk. Rideshare services are also a viable option, with drivers familiar with the area. When planning your arrival, consider the typical local traffic patterns, which can be heavier during weekday rush hours and weekend evenings. Arriving about 15-20 minutes before your scheduled session or party start time is usually recommended to account for parking and entry procedures.

Louisville Zoo
A short drive from Robben's Roost, the Louisville Zoo offers a fantastic opportunity for families and visitors to explore a diverse range of animal exhibits. Spread across 50 acres, the zoo is home to over 1,000 animals, including many endangered species. Visitors can wander through areas like the African Outpost, Herpetarium, and the popular Islands exhibit. It's an ideal spot for a few hours of exploration, providing a more relaxed pace than the energetic atmosphere of the roller rink and offering both indoor and outdoor attractions suitable for various weather conditions.
